首先搭建ELK,其中es和kibana没有特别要求,能正常访问即可logstash需要配置接收kafka的消息 log4j2配置 依赖 在resources目录下创建EcsLayout.json文件 写一个测试方法 ...
默认你已经安装配置了Zookeeper和Kafka。 为了目录清晰,我的Kafka配置文件的Zookeeper部分是:加上了节点用来存放Kafka信息 启动Zookeeper,然后启动Kafka。 Zookeeper的节点树:根目录下有专门的Kafka存放节点 以前没有配这个,结果Kafka的一大堆东西全部跑到根节点上了,很乱 接下来是代码部分了。 依赖包: Log j 配置文件: 生产者: 消费 ...
2017-10-28 11:29 0 5286 推荐指数:
首先搭建ELK,其中es和kibana没有特别要求,能正常访问即可logstash需要配置接收kafka的消息 log4j2配置 依赖 在resources目录下创建EcsLayout.json文件 写一个测试方法 ...
一、Log4j2 Maven配置 Log4j2的性能高于log4j与logback,在项目中建议使用Log4j2,其依赖如下(目前最新版本为2.6.2): 二、log4j2.xml文件配置 log4j2.xml的配置文件放在classpath下就会被自动加载,其配置 ...
背景 log4j2相对于log4j 1.x有了脱胎换骨的变化,其官网宣称的优势有多线程下10几倍于log4j 1.x和logback的高吞吐量、可配置的审计型日志、基于插件架构的各种灵活配置等。 官方配置文档:http://logging.apache.org/log4j/2.x ...
pom.xml配置依赖 application.yml配置 log4j2.xml配置模板 ...
目录 1.日志框架 2.为什么需要日志接口,直接使用具体的实现不就行了吗? 3.log4j2日志级别 4.log4j2配置文件的优先级 5.对于log4j2配置文件的理解 6.对于Appender的理解 7.对于Logger的理解 ...
默认日志Logback SLF4J——Simple Logging Facade For Java,它是一个针对于各类Java日志框架的统一Facade抽象。Java日志框架众多——常用的有java.util.logging, log4j, logback,commons-logging ...
一、常用日志框架以及其关系 目前我们常见的日志框架为log4j、log4j2、logback,他们三者关系为,最先有log4j,然后作者觉得log4j有很大的性能问题因此又重写了一个logback,并抽象出一个日志门面slf4j。由于之前log4j的问世,Apache就借鉴了log4j ...
来搭建他们的企业微服务项目,此篇文章是博主在实践中用Springboot整合log4j2日志的总结。 ...